Office market Berlin Q3 2011

The Berlin office market showed a space take-up of 398,400 sq m in the first three quarters of the current year, 36% higher than the same period in the previous year. As in the two previous quarters, the largest take-up was in the City-East submarket. The Berlin office vacancy rate has settled at around the level of the previous quarter at 9.4%. Overall, 209,700 sq m office space was completed by the end of the third quarter. Of this, almost three quarters were already prelet. The prime rental level at the end of the third quarter remained unchanged at €22.00 /sq m/month. It stabilised at this level after a rise of 4.8% in the first quarter. The weighted average rent rose year-on-year by 13% to €13.02 /sq m/month.
